3 3 NAVFAC WASHINGTON 26 October 2005 NDW Re-Alignment NAVFAC WASHINGTON Supports Five Navy Installations, Marine Corps, Air Force, and other DOD and Non-DOD Clients. Five Navy Installations: NSA Washington NAS Patuxent NSA North Potomac NSA South Potomac NSA Annapolis Each Installation is supported by a NAVFAC WASH Public Works Department 6 TH Area of Responsibility is Quantico / DIA and Misc. 6 6 NAVFAC WASHINGTON 26 October 2005 NAVFAC E-Business Initiatives NAVFAC is aggressively pursuing e-Business Initiatives ESOL: Electronic Solicitations On Line -On-Line bid specifications and documents WebCM: Web Construction Management -Web-based Construction Management for all field offices -Standardized platform used by NAVFAC, A-Es, Contractors, and Clients -* Revitalizing Mgmt Tool E-FSC: Electronic Facilities Service Contracts -DoN e-Business pilot -Using DoD eMALL, allows web-based, client-self ordering of service work using purchase card -Task order processing time reduced by 80%

8 8 NAVFAC WASHINGTON 26 October 2005 NAVFAC’s Preferred Acquisition: Design Build vs Design Bid Build -FY07 - 75% of all MILCONs DB -Near Future - 75% of all projects over $750k DB Best Value Source Selection RFP (Request for Proposal) vs. IFB (Invitation for Bid) NAVFAC Acquisition

9 9 NAVFAC WASHINGTON 26 October 2005 Architectural: 9 contracts, 5 yrs, exp 07/07 to 08/09 Mech/Elec: 5 contracts, 5 yrs, exp 07/06 to 06/08 Civil/Structural: 4 contracts, 5 yrs, exp 09/07 to 09/09 Environ: 6 contracts, 5 yrs, exp 08/07 to 07/08 Planning: 5 contracts, 5 yrs, exp 04/06 to 03/08 Misc Svcs (i.e.,Cost Est, Title II): 3 contracts, 5 yrs, exp 04/07 to 05/08 NAVFAC A&E IDQ Contracts

10 10 NAVFAC WASHINGTON 26 October 2005 @ NAVFAC Washington Large MACs: 7 contracts, expire 05/09 MID MACs: 13 contracts, exp 06/09 8(a) MACs: In planning stage for FY06 Award Environmental MACs: 4 contracts, exp 3/07 JOCs: 1 contract, Native Alaskan Award, exp 03/07 Also Available: Admin MACs Industrial MACs Medical MACs NAVFAC Construction Contracts

11 11 NAVFAC WASHINGTON 26 October 2005 NAVFAC Projected Work FY06 MILCON 11 projects$195M CNI/USNA11 projects$ 40M FY07 MILCON10 projects$150M FY07-FY10 BRACON12 projects$ TBD
